
Join fans of Somerville's local history to hear historian, Michael Bonislawski talk about the men from Charlestown (aka Somerville) who formed the Colonial "Rabble Militia" of June 1775. How did they become the formidable fighting force that caused the most powerful military on earth to evacuate Boston only nine months later?
Dr. Bonislawski is an Assistant Professor of American History at Salem State College. In his spare time, he is Adjutant Lieutenant Field Commander of the living history group, Gardner's Regiment of Charlestown. He is particularly interested in researching the lives of the men who formed the original company.
